Arsenal forward Gabriel Martinelli backs striker Viktor Gyokeres to be a huge hit at the Emirates, despite going a month without scoring. The Brazilian also spoke about his role within the Gunners squad and the competition for places as Mikel Arteta’s men hunt for the big trophies this season.
